RTX 5080 Legion Pro 7i drops to $2,549 with 32 GB RAM and 2 TB storage
B&H Photo is selling the Lenovo Legion Pro 7i for $2,549. The 16-inch model includes an Nvidia GeForce RTX 5080, 32 GB of DDR5 RAM and a 2 TB SSD, and is powered by an Intel Core Ultra 9 275HX, a 24-core hybrid chip with eight performance cores. Its OLED panel runs at 2560 x 1600 with a 240 Hz refresh rate.
This is the cheapest price seen in 2026, although the laptop sold for roughly $200 less late last year. Ongoing memory shortages—the so-called "RAMpocalypse"—have kept system memory prices elevated, and the same configuration is listed for about $3,100 on Amazon.
The OLED display offers deep blacks and high refresh performance for games, while the large SSD and 32 GB of RAM provide ample space for modern titles and updates. Potential buyers should note the machine is fairly chunky and its outer shell attracts fingerprints, which may be drawbacks for some.
